Alzheimer's disease is distinguished from other types of dementia in DSM-5 based on
 
  a. muscular impairment.
  b. personality changes.
  c. the gradual speed of onset.
  d. more significant memory impairment.

Calcitonin is a naturally occurring hormone. In women who are at least 5 years beyond menopause, it slows bone loss and increases spinal bone density.
